Tell us about Hylands Estate...
Hylands Estate, comprising of Hylands Park and Hylands House, has had a vast and varied history. Chelmsford City Council is the tenth owner of the now beautifully restored Hylands Estate.

Hylands was built around 1730, for Sir John Comyns; the original house was a red brick Queen Anne style mansion with approximately 400 acres of land. Now, in the 21st Century, Hylands Estate is a Grade II* listed mansion enjoyed by thousands of people who visit the park and use Hylands House as the wedding venue of their dreams, with the Grand Pavilion added in 2014, allowing for a sleek and contemporary feel for larger wedding parties.

What kind of weddings do you get at the venue?
We are proud of our ability to accommodate all ceremonies; ranging from an intimate ceremony of 80 guests to cultural ceremonies for 300 guests in the Grand Pavilion. Our ceremony spaces are simply perfect for both lavish and intimate ceremonies with family and friends.

For those wanting to have a wedding with up to 120 guests, your civil ceremony and wedding reception can take place in the ornate, historic rooms of Hylands House. For larger wedding parties of up to 300 guests, host your civil ceremony in our ornate Banqueting Room before progressing to the sleek and contemporary Grand Pavilion for your evening reception.

What services do you offer?
At Hylands Estate, we understand that flexibility is important to meet the bespoke requirements for your wedding and that is why we offer our venue on a completely dry hire basis. Our experienced Events & Wedding Team specialise in dry hire weddings and deliver impeccable service from beginning to end. This allows you the flexibility to choose your own contractors, including your own caterer, décor and entertainment. You can even bring in your own drinks and operate from our bar using a designated caterer or external bar company with no hidden corkage charges.

Can couples make use of the grounds?
Hylands Estate encompasses 574 acres of gorgeous parkland, available to the public and to anyone hosting their wedding with us. A small lily pond, flanked by two oak arbours clad in wisteria and borders containing beautiful seasonal flowers can be found within our ornate Victorian Pleasure Gardens, a short walk away from Hylands House, and the beautiful formal gardens date back to the early 1900's. With an impressive planting scheme, creating a beautiful display and stunning backdrop for your wedding photography, take advantage of this delightful feature in the Spring and Summer months for some truly unforgettable memories.
